Output e10c87ec36ca771cb72dfd1901f7ae6cbcfa26314c2d07a5e8a87e450142b33f:1

value
9416756239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da5dbd2650d17cec2cddc128f1940fb7619c02ad OP_EQUALVERIFY OP_CHECKSIG
address
1Lucbukx5o9UbEyFbYGLDvVLWMsM4hPjtA
transaction
e10c87ec36ca771cb72dfd1901f7ae6cbcfa26314c2d07a5e8a87e450142b33f
confirmations
514250
spent
true